Usps Package To Pattaya

Featured Replies

Hello,

I purchased something back on 15 June, but had not received it yet. I looked online with the Confirmation No. and it says "Delivery Attempted" last Thursday at 7:30 PM. However since then there is no activity on my package, and nobody has come to deliver it.

Does anyone know where my package might be (local main post office - ?) that I might inquire about it? It was sent US Postal Service to me in Pattaya.

Thanks for any help.

Worried WaatWang

Postman should have left a note. Pick up at local post office and bring ID. I often have usps deliveries and if small, they will deliver.

It usually ends up at the post office in Naklua.

Depends on the zip-code:

asaik 20260 will go to the new post office Na-Jomtien along Sukhumvit near the interesction with Chayapruk II and 20150 will end up in the Banglamung (Naklua) postoffice.

DO NOT wait too long with the recovery of your parcel, because they usually hold it for 14 days and than it will be "returned to the sender".

Head north from the Dolphin roundabout on Pattaya-Naklua Road to the traffic light just before the Naklua Food market.

Turn right at the traffic light on to Sawang Fa Rd. The post office will be on your right after 3-400 meters.
